Movement Moment

Hide and Seek Stars

Supplies:

  • Two copies of the free printable colouring sheet (or the full-colour version available on TPT). If you have more than 10 children, print a third copy of the colouring sheet to make additional stars.
  • Scissors
  • Crayons, markers, pencil crayons, etc.
  • Optional: Consider using thicker paper and/or laminating your Hide and Seek Stars board and pieces for greater durability.

Prep:

  • Alternatively, if you prefer to print a full-colour version, check out the 10 Matching Stars on my TPT store.
  • Decorate the stars keeping the matching stars looking like they match (i.e. the star with five dots should be the same colour on both sheets of paper so that they are evidently a pair.)
  • Cut out the stars from one sheet of paper (these are your stars to hide). Do not cut the other sheet of paper (this is your matching board).

Time to Play:

  • “Hide” the stars around the room in obvious places. Consider placing one on a chair, on a windowsill, or even straight on the floor.
  • Place the matching board in the center of the room. Gather your children around and show them the stars. Discuss what colours they are.
  • Explain to your children that you have hidden the stars around the room. Their job is to find the stars and match them to their pair on the matching board.
  • Be excited with the children as they find each star.

Art Activity

Star Shadows

Supplies:

  • Paper
  • Cardboard or thick cardstock
  • Scissors
  • Crayons (Alternatively use paint, or use light coloured oil pastels on black paper.)
  • Tape

Prep:

  • Cut out stars from the cardboard. You need at least one per child who will be doing art at the same time.
  • Optional: Cut out a moon.

Time to Create:

  • Invite your children to the table. Show them the cardboard star.
  • Demonstrate how to make a star shadow picture by doing an example: put a ball of tape on the back of the cardboard star. Secure the star to the middle of your paper.
  • Use a crayon to draw from the cardboard onto the paper all around the cardboard star.
  • Remove the cardboard star and admire the star shadow.
  • Secure a star to your child’s paper and encourage them to try.
